Specification:
- CPU Cores: 6
- CPU Threads: 12
- Base Clock: 4.70GHz
- Max Boost Clock: 5.30GHz
- L1 Cache: 384KB
- L2 Cache: 6MB
- L3 Cache: 32MB
- TDP: 105W
- Process: TSMC 5nm FinFet
- Unlocked for Overclocking: YES
- Socket: AM5
- Cooler included: NO
- Max operating temperature: 95c
- OS Support: Windows 10 64-Bit, Windows 11 64-bit, RHEL x86 64-bit, Ubuntu 64-Bit
- Memory supported: DDR5 5200-6000MHz
- AMD Graphics: Yes
- AMD EXPO Technology
- AMD Ryzen Technologies
- Warranty: 3yr

In ITX PC : Single boosting - 5450-5475mhz, multi 4950-5050mhz, in games 5400mhz. ECO MODE (65W), Power Usage Reduced from 105 to around 80-90 (if I remember well) done it while ago.. PBO negative -20. Temps are high but not more then 80-85*C in full load all cores. Sometimes even less defend how I will set up Fans in ITX case... could be also 56*C cinebench single, 76*C cinebench multi depend fan curve or dB level noise set up. Cooled by Bequiet Loop 120. Could be in my opinion cooled easly by medium price air flow fan. Worth to reduce power stage limit and pbo. I will wait for version 65W because reduction of power level not make effect on scores TBH so You may buy better CPU with more core soon in same money or 7600 non-X cheaper. I buyed for 335 (in my opinion was overpriced then) , now current price around 265 is in right place. For new builders will be perfect to se non-X models 7600 for 200-225 or 7700 for 280-300 in my opinion. But time will show. Regards.
